Package com.exasol.sql
Class Column
- java.lang.Object
-
- com.exasol.sql.AbstractFragment
-
- com.exasol.sql.Column
-
- All Implemented Interfaces:
Fragment
public class Column extends AbstractFragment
This class represents a column in an SQL statement
-
-
Field Summary
-
Fields inherited from class com.exasol.sql.AbstractFragment
root
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accept(ColumnDefinitionVisitor visitor)Accept aColumnDefinitionVisitor.StringgetColumnName()Get the column nameDataTypegetDataType()Get the column data type-
Methods inherited from class com.exasol.sql.AbstractFragment
getRoot
-
-
-
-
Method Detail
-
getColumnName
public String getColumnName()
Get the column name- Returns:
- column name
-
accept
public void accept(ColumnDefinitionVisitor visitor)
Accept aColumnDefinitionVisitor.- Parameters:
visitor- visitor to accept
-
-